CHICAGO - The northern lights did indeed stage a minor encore last night and while nowhere near as spectacular as Tuesday night, many folks did capture photos in Chicagoland.
What's next:
Today we will start with sunshine and temperatures in the 30s. We’ll have enough sun to get our highs into the mid 50s just like yesterday, but there will be a little increase in cloud coverage during the afternoon.
Tonight, skies will clear and it will be seasonably chilly with lows not far from 40.
Weekend forecast:
Tomorrow will be warmer with plenty of sunshine as highs soar into the low 60s. Tomorrow night will be pleasant with lows in the low 50s.
